Samsung releases Pink Galaxy S in South Korea

Samsung releases Pink Galaxy S in South Korea

  Well here it is. As we had expected Samsung has launched Pink-colored Galaxy S for its home market. The new color will appeal to women that is said to give a “romantic and cute” look. South Koreans can now buy Samsung’s top-end Android smartphone in three colors — Black, Snow White and Femme Pink.
